Skyr, a slimming ally with many benefits

The yogurt in question is skyr, a product of Icelandic origin. Highly appreciated for its thick texture and slightly tangy taste, it has interesting nutritional benefits:

  • Rich in protein: it helps prolong satiety and limits cravings;
  • Low in fat: ideal for controlling your caloric intake;
  • Source of calcium: beneficial for bone health.

Be careful of versions that are too sweet

If skyr is an excellent choice, Alexandra Murcier warns against certain pitfalls. Not all products are equal, and some skyrs contain too much sugar or additives. She therefore advises:

  • Favor a short list of ingredients, without unnecessary additives;
  • Avoid flavored versions:Be careful to choose the least processed skyr possible because there are many flavored and very sweet skyrs (tiramisu flavor, crème brûlée, etc.). With these products, we move away from the initial benefits because they are too sweet or rich in sweeteners.”specifies Alexandra Murcier;
  • Sweeten naturally with fresh fruit rather than processed products.

Less expensive alternatives

If the price of skyr is holding you back, don’t panic! Alexandra Murcier suggests two economic alternatives with similar benefits:

  • Cottage cheese: a protein content close to skyr;
  • The little Swiss: a creamier option, rich in calcium.
